Visitors to the basement archive room at Doverell House must be escorted at all times by a member of the facilities team, sign the ledger on entry and exit, and leave coats and bags in the locker bank by the stairwell. Should the escort need to admit a visitor through the inner door, use the access code that follows.

staff pass of kagup-fajog = bdg-QCHVQW-99665837

## Build Provenance: Deep-Link Routing (Wrenloft Mobile)

Welcome aboard! Quick primer on how deep-link routing ties into provenance. Every Wrenloft mobile build bakes its route manifest in at compile time, so a link that works on one build can 404 on another — that's by design, not a bug. When debugging a broken deep link, your first move is always: find out exactly which build the user is on, then pull that build's manifest. Each build is identified by the short token below.

session token of tajef-bageg = htk21_5d90d574934f3ccae6437

## TICKET-883: Rebalancer failing on staging

The Corvane rebalancing tool errors out when pulling dock occupancy. Root cause: staging env was copied from the old worker and is missing two vars. Station polling interval has been restored. The remaining gap blocks the occupancy feed entirely, so no rebalancing runs will succeed until it's fixed. To complete the fix, append this line to rebalancer.env:

vault entry, yajop-bafop: ARCHIVE_KEY3=8d4

Onboarding: Grindle ledger tables are partitioned by month. New partitions are created by the `partmaker` job on the 25th; never create them by hand. Release cuts must not run while partmaker is mid-rotation — check the lock table first. Drops older than 18 months happen automatically. Backfills go through the Quarrow queue, not direct inserts. Releases touching partition DDL must be signed before deploy. Use the key below.

deploy key for yagap-kawig: bky4_Q8dK